Corona scare: 16 people in Handwara put under observation

All six cases test negative in Tral

Handwara: 16 people have been kept under observation in Handwara here in north Kashmir after a woman from the town with acute infection was admitted at SKIMS.
Reports said that a woman from Beeripora Handwara, having travel history to an affected country and with Coronavirus like symptoms has been admitted at SKIMS a couple of days back.
While providing information about the issue, Block Medical Officer Handwara, Dr Abdul Majid said that they have quarantined 16 people in ITI Handwara who have possibly come in contact with the woman who is admitted in SKMIS.
All these 16 people, both male and female who hail from Nathnusa and Beeripora of Handwara are under observation.
“We have collected the samples of these people and sent them to the laboratory for testing. We are waiting for their reports and at present they all are in quarantine,” the BMO said.
The BMO said that all these people have been quarantined for 14 days. He said the report of the woman from Beeripora is still awaited.
Meanwhile, all the reports of six patients from South Kashmir Tral town have pro ved negative.
Assistant Development Commissioner Tral, Shabir Ahmed Raina said that six patients with Coronavirus symptoms from different parts of Tral had been quarantined at two places and their reports have turned out to be negative. He said that situation is under control in Tral and people are being advised to stay indoors. (KNT)
